Bug description:
  [Description]

  Kubernetes 1.16.17
  Containerd 1.3.3
  Ubuntu Bionic

  [Affected Releases]

   containerd | 1.3.3-0ubuntu1~18.04.1 | bionic-updates/universe  | source, amd64, arm64, armhf, i386, ppc64el, s390x
   containerd | 1.3.3-0ubuntu1~19.10.1 | eoan-updates/universe    | source, amd64, arm64, armhf, i386, ppc64el, s390x
   containerd | 1.3.3-0ubuntu1         | focal                    | source, amd64, arm64, armhf, ppc64el, s390x

  [Impact]

  Reported upstream:
  https://github.com/containerd/containerd/issues/4108

  User Impact:

  Since the Ubuntu bionic-updates bump of the version 1.3.3 through [0] https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/containerd/+bug/1854841
  a regression was introduced.

  The following endpoint description stopped working when scheduling
  pods with k8s 1.16-1.17 isn't longer working.

      [plugins."io.containerd.grpc.v1.cri".registry.mirrors."ni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:5000"]
        endpoint = ["ni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:5000"]

  As an example, creating a k8s pod defined as following:

  apiVersion: v1
  kind: Pod
  metadata:
    name: busybox
    namespace: default
  spec:
    containers:
      - name: busybox
        image: ni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:5000/busybox:latest
        command:
          - sleep
          - "3600"
    imagePullSecrets:
      - name: regcred
    restartPolicy: Always

  Will fail in the current Bionic-updates version with the following
  error:

  " failed to do request: Head niedbalski-
  bastion.cloud.sts:///v2/busybox/manifests/latest: unsupported protocol
  scheme "ni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ts"

  Normal Scheduled default-scheduler Successfully assigned default/busybox to juju-3a79d2-00268738-4
  Normal Pulling 8m39s (x4 over 10m) kubelet, juju-3a79d2-00268738-4 Pulling image "ni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:5000/busybox:latest"
  Warning Failed 8m39s (x4 over 10m) kubelet, juju-3a79d2-00268738-4 Failed to pull image "ni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:5000/busybox:latest": rpc error: code = Unknown desc = failed to pull and unpack image "ni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:5000/busybox:latest": failed to resolve reference "ni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:5000/busybox:latest": failed to do request: Head ni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:///v2/busybox/manifests/latest: unsupported protocol scheme "ni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ts"
  Warning Failed 8m39s (x4 over 10m) kubelet, juju-3a79d2-00268738-4 Error: ErrImagePull
  Warning Failed 8m27s (x6 over 10m) kubelet, juju-3a79d2-00268738-4 Error: ImagePullBackOff
  Normal BackOff 4m56s (x21 over 10m) kubelet, juju-3a79d2-00268738-4 Back-off pulling image "niedbalski-bastion.cloud.sts:5000/busybox:latest"

  [Test Case]

  1) Configure a private docker repository repository

  2)  Modify the containerd registry mirror config as follows:
  ** http://paste.ubuntu.com/p/yP63WMkVT6/

  3) Execute the following pod (http://paste.ubuntu.com/p/BVYQFMfCmk/)

  Status of the scheduled pod should be ImagePullBackOff
  and the before mentioned error should be raised.

  [Possible workaround and solution]

  As a workaround change the endpoint to support the scheme (https://)
  Provide a fallback mechanism for URL parsing validation to fallback to http or https.
  I suspect that this change introduced on 1.3.3 through
  0b29c9c) may be the offending commit.

  [Regression Potential]

  ** The change proposed on the SRU takes in consideration both cases
  1) a endpoint without a schema 2) a endpoint with a schema.

  1) worked in 1.2.6 as explained in the "Impact section" and stopped
  being supported with the current Bionic version 1.3.3, 2) Should work
  on both cases.

  In neither case this should break existing endpoint definitions
  now new deployments of containerd.

  [Other Info]

  ** This commit upstream
  https://github.com/containerd/containerd/commit/a022c218194c05449ad69b69c48fc6cac9d6f0b3
  addresses the issue.
